CPWA and County Water Authority Ink Deal

2/26/2010
The Clifton Park Water Authority and the Saratoga County Water Authority have finished a deal that will have the CPWA purchasing a minimum of 500,000 gallons of water per day. The CPWA has contracted with Trinity Construction to build the connection to the County system, and water should begin to flow into the Clifton Park system sometime in April. The purchase from the County represents about 1/6th of the average daily demand on the CPWA system. As a result, customers in the northern end of the system, mostly north of Ushers Road, should receive a majority of their water from the SCWA system. This will mean softer water for those customers. The CPWA has CT Male Associates looking at the possibility of softening the water at its Boyack Road Treatment Plant, which supplies approximately 60% of the system's water on a daily basis.
